The Isfara Branch Campus of Khujand State University serves as an important educational center in the northeastern part of Tajikistan. This campus extends the university’s mission to provide accessible higher education to students in remote and rural areas of Sogd Province. It focuses on regional development by offering programs tailored to the needs of the local community.
The curriculum at the Isfara Branch emphasizes practical and vocational skills alongside traditional academic disciplines. This approach ensures that graduates are well-prepared to contribute to the local economy and societal growth.
This campus plays a vital role in decentralizing education in Tajikistan, making higher learning accessible to students who may not be able to relocate to Khujand. The Isfara Branch is equipped with essential facilities, including classrooms, libraries, and computer labs, to support student learning. It also engages with local authorities and organizations to align its programs with regional needs, fostering a sense of community and responsibility among students. Through its efforts, the campus contributes significantly to the educational and economic upliftment of the Isfara region.
The Panjakent Branch Campus of Khujand State University is strategically located in the historic city of Panjakent, known for its rich cultural and archaeological heritage. This campus aims to bring quality education to the western part of Sogd Province, supporting students who seek higher education closer to their hometowns. It upholds the university’s commitment to academic excellence and regional development.
The academic offerings at this branch are designed to meet the specific needs of the local population while maintaining the university’s high standards. The focus is on creating skilled professionals who can contribute to the socio-economic growth of the area.
The Panjakent Branch Campus provides a supportive learning environment with access to basic academic resources and facilities. It also encourages students to participate in cultural activities and research related to the region’s historical sites, fostering a deep connection to their heritage. By offering relevant and accessible education, this campus plays a crucial role in empowering the youth of Panjakent and surrounding areas, helping them build sustainable careers while contributing to the preservation and development of their community.
Khujand State University’s Main Campus in Khujand is the central hub for academic and administrative activities. Established in 1932, it is one of the oldest and most prestigious institutions in Tajikistan, offering a wide range of programs across various disciplines. The campus is dedicated to fostering academic excellence and cultural development in the northern region of the country.
The main courses taught at this campus cover a broad spectrum of fields, catering to both undergraduate and postgraduate students. The university is particularly renowned for its programs in education, humanities, and natural sciences, reflecting its historical focus on teacher training and research.
In addition to these core programs, the campus offers specialized courses in law, technology, and arts, ensuring a multidisciplinary approach to education. With modern facilities, libraries, and research centers, the Main Campus provides a conducive environment for learning and intellectual growth. It also hosts various cultural and academic events, connecting students with the rich heritage of Tajikistan while preparing them for modern challenges.
